The IBM Full Stack Software Developer Certificate is a Coursera program, and you take it at coursera.org. You can audit most of the individual courses for free, which gets you the video lessons and readings. The hands-on labs, graded projects, and the certificate need a Coursera subscription or per-course payment, and financial aid is available. There is no separate free IBM-hosted version, so Coursera is the path. We are not in Coursera's affiliate program, so we earn nothing whichever track you pick. Audit it if you only want to follow along, or pay for the full track if you need the labs and the IBM credential.
The certificate runs across roughly a dozen courses and about 240 hours, covering front end, back end, cloud, and containers (source: coursera.org IBM Full Stack Software Developer certificate page).

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I take the IBM certificate free?
You can audit the lessons. The labs, graded work, and certificate require payment or Coursera financial aid.
What does it cover?
HTML, CSS, JavaScript, React, Node, Express, and MongoDB, plus Docker, Kubernetes, and microservices on IBM Cloud.
Is it beginner-friendly?
It starts from basics but moves into cloud and DevOps topics, so plan for a longer, intermediate-level commitment.
Certificate track or audit, what's the trade-off?
Audit is free but has no graded labs or credential. The paid track unlocks the projects and the IBM certificate for your resume.
